COMANCO Environmental has completed a 30-acre Construction & Debris (C & D) Landfill Closure project near Orlando, FL. A 40-mil HDPE geomembrane & DS 200-mil Geocomposite were deployed over a prepared sub-grade. Now, 2’ of protective cover & topsoil materials …
COMANCO Environmental has recently begun deployment of a gyp stack expansion project in North Florida. The liner crew has currently installed approximately over 349,131 square feet of 60mil double-sided HDPE geomembrane and 31,385 square feet of geocomposite vent strips. Superintendent …

Last Week at the COMANCO corporate office, ten employees attended CPR (cardiopulmonary resuscitation), First Aid, and AED (automated external defibrillator) training.
